Puzzle Logo

Puzzle

Senior Software Engineer (Accounting)

Reposted 5 Days Ago
Remote
2 Locations
Senior level
Remote
2 Locations
Senior level
Design and build a financial data platform. Develop APIs and systems for accurate financial information management and reporting.
The summary above was generated by AI

Puzzle is revolutionizing accounting software by creating modern, user-friendly solutions that give companies better control over their finances. Our platform connects with popular fintech tools to provide real-time financial insights to founders and finance teams.

What we're looking for

As part of Puzzle, you will help design and build a next generation financial data platform. We will be ingesting large amounts of data from disparate sources, transforming them, organizing them, and automatically turning them into easily understandable company financials.

We want to be as real-time as possible, event-driven, and decoupled. Redundant, resistant and secure. And accuracy is key. This is your opportunity to be an early engineer at a well-funded startup that has a successful founder and a drive to change how company's leverage their financials. We are remote-first — anywhere in the US works for us.

As a Sr. SWE, you will help architect, design, productize and build key parts of our financial system and immutable, event-driven ledger.

What you'll do

  • Working directly with our product team, deliver on core accounting, auditing and financial infrastructure

  • Architect and build robust APIs to interact with our platform, ensuring scalability, security, and ease of integration

  • Build systems to keep information up to date and accurate

  • Create unique functionality for correlation of data

  • Extend and architect our event pipeline for speed and scale

  • Extend our core reporting platform

  • Handle an ever growing stream of data

Who you are

  • 6+ years as a software engineer

  • Experience with agile software development methodologies

  • Experience building out APIs/Integrations (REST)

  • Experience in a modern programming language like Python

  • Strong experience with Databases design (SQL, NoSQL) and analytics

  • An understanding of and desire to bring company financials into the 21st century

  • A background in finance or accounting, with a solid grasp of financial principles and practices or equivalent experience working in fintech.

  • Experience with GraphQL a plus

Puzzle is an equal opportunity and affirmative action employer. We welcome and encourage diversity in the workplace regardless of gender, race or color, ethnicity or national origin, age, disability, religion, sexual orientation, gender identity or expression, veteran status, or any other characteristics protected by law.

Candidates should be currently residing in the U.S. or Canada to be eligible for this position. If hired, you will be required to present proof of work authorization. This employer is a participant of the E-Verify program.

Top Skills

GraphQL
NoSQL
Python
Rest
SQL

Similar Jobs

2 Hours Ago
Remote
United States
Senior level
Senior level
Artificial Intelligence • Big Data • Cloud • Information Technology • Software • Cybersecurity • Data Privacy
The Cloud Automation & Integration Engineer will automate deployment processes, develop custom integrations, and ensure effective project delivery, leveraging scripting and API skills.
Top Skills: AWSAzureGraphQLPowershellPythonRest ApisTerraformWebhooks
2 Hours Ago
Easy Apply
Remote
US
Easy Apply
Junior
Junior
Cloud • Security • Software • Cybersecurity • Automation
The Associate Solutions Architect will provide technical guidance during the sales process, engage with customers, support sales strategies, and maintain relationships to ensure successful adoption of GitLab solutions.
Top Skills: Gitlab
2 Hours Ago
Easy Apply
Remote
United States
Easy Apply
Senior level
Senior level
Big Data • Cloud • Information Technology • Software • Database • Analytics • Big Data Analytics
Design, develop, and maintain data connectors for Starburst products, collaborate with global teams, and enhance software quality while providing customer support.
Top Skills: JavaLakehouse ArchitectureOpen SourceSaaSTrino

What you need to know about the Montreal Tech Scene

With roots dating back to 1642, Montreal is often recognized for its French-inspired architecture and cobblestone streets lined with traditional shops and cafés. But what truly sets the city apart is how it blends its rich tradition with a modern edge, reflected in its evolving skyline and fast-growing tech industry. According to economic promotion agency Montréal International, the city ranks among the top in North America to invest in artificial intelligence, making it le spot idéal for job seekers who want the best of both worlds.

Key Facts About Montreal Tech

  • Number of Tech Workers: 255,000+ (2024, Tourisme Montréal)
  • Major Tech Employers: SAP, Google, Microsoft, Cisco
  • Key Industries: Artificial intelligence, machine learning, cybersecurity, cloud computing, web development
  • Funding Landscape: $1.47 billion in venture capital funding in 2024 (BetaKit)
  • Notable Investors: CIBC Innovation Banking, BDC Capital, Investissement Québec, Fonds de solidarité FTQ
  • Research Centers and Universities: McGill University, Université de Montréal, Concordia University, Mila Quebec, ÉTS Montréal

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account